When is the best time to visit Rajasthan?
The best time to visit Rajasthan is October to March, when days are warm and dry and evenings are cool — ideal for exploring forts, palaces and the desert. April to June is very hot and the monsoon arrives July to September.
What is Rajasthan known for?
Rajasthan is known for its maharaja palaces and hilltop forts, the pink city of Jaipur, the lake palaces of Udaipur, the blue city of Jodhpur, the Thar Desert and vibrant craft and textile traditions.
